- What is this tool?
- Overjet analyzes dental X-rays to detect cavities, bone loss, and other oral health issues.
- How much does it cost?
- Overjet offers a freemium pricing model with a free tier; detailed paid pricing is not publicly disclosed.
- Does it have a free plan?
- Yes, Overjet provides a free plan with basic dental X-ray analysis features.
- What integrations does it support?
- Overjet integrates clinical data with dental imaging but does not publicly list third-party software integrations.
- Who is it best for?
- It is best suited for dental professionals and insurance providers needing precise dental imaging analysis.
